374Water“There’s quite a lot of destruction that must be executed,” sums up Parker Bovée of Cleantech Group, a analysis and consulting agency.
He’s referring to PFAS (Perfluoroalkyl and Polyfluoroalkyl Substances), also referred to as “without end chemical compounds”.
These man-made chemical compounds could be present in objects equivalent to waterproof clothes, non-stick pans, lipsticks and meals packaging.
They’re used for his or her grease and water repellence, however don’t degrade rapidly and have been linked to well being points equivalent to greater dangers of sure cancers and reproductive issues.
The terribly robust carbon-fluorine bonds they comprise provides them the flexibility to persist for many years and even centuries in nature.
PFAS could be detected and faraway from water and soil after which concentrated into smaller volumes of excessive power waste.
However what to do with that waste?
Presently, concentrated PFAS waste is both put in long-term storage which is dear, or incinerated (usually incompletely, resulting in poisonous emissions), or despatched to landfills for hazardous waste.
However now clean-tech firms are bringing strategies to market that may destroy them.
These are being examined in small-scale pilot initiatives with potential prospects together with some industrial producers, municipal wastewater therapy vegetation and even the US navy.
There is a “giant and rising” market alternative for PFAS destruction firms notes Mr Bovée.
Whereas it’s principally at the moment centred within the US, others are dipping their toes, he says.
Within the UK, funding for water firms to look into PFAS destruction has been offered by water regulator Ofwat, with Severn Trent Water leading a project to look at the potential applied sciences and suppliers.
One issue driving the market ahead within the US is authorized threat. Hundreds of lawsuits claiming PFAS-related contamination and hurt have been filed with some giant chemical producers, notably 3M, having already paid out billions in class-action settlements.
Regulation can be starting to tighten worldwide.
Authorized limits for 2 PFAS in consuming water are actually scheduled to take impact within the US in 2031.
PFAS stays a bipartisan subject, says Mr Bovée, and lots of count on that future US regulation will increase past consuming water to cowl industrial discharge and different sources.
The EU additionally has authorized limits for PFAS in consuming water, which member states should start implementing from subsequent 12 months.
Axine Water Applied sciencesThere are a number of applied sciences for destroying PFAS – every with their very own benefits and limitations.
In line with Mr Bovée, one expertise that’s virtually commercially prepared is electrochemical oxidation (EO) expertise.
Electrodes are positioned in water contaminated by PFAS and a present is handed by way of, ensuing within the chemical compounds’ breakdown.
Whereas power intensive, it would not require excessive temperature or stress, and is straightforward to function and combine into present therapy techniques for concentrating PFAS, says Mark Ralph, CEO of Canadian-based start-up Axine Water Applied sciences.
Final 12 months, following a profitable pilot challenge, it bought its first commercial-scale unit to a Michigan-based producer of automotive parts. It’s now up and working and the shopper is planning to buy extra techniques for different websites.
374WaterOne other expertise not far behind is Supercritical Water Oxidation (SCWO).
It depends on heating and pressurising water to such a excessive diploma that it enters a brand new state of matter: a so-called supercritical state. When the PFAS waste stream is launched, it breaks the carbon-fluorine bonds.
One benefit is that it will possibly course of each stable and liquid PFAS waste, says Chris Gannon, CEO of North Carolina-based 374Water.
He says his expertise may even destroy PFAS in plastics if they’re floor up.
It may be costly to purchase and preserve – the method is so intense it requires a fancy reactor and common cleansing. However it may be more economical if the PFAS is first concentrated earlier than it enters the method.
Presently the Metropolis of Orlando in Florida is testing 374Water’s expertise at its largest wastewater therapy plant.
The Metropolis is making an attempt to get forward of the curve, explains Alan Oyler, its particular initiatives supervisor for public works.
Ranges of PFAS in sewage sludge aren’t at the moment regulated, however he expects them to be sooner or later.
To this point, Mr Oyler is happy with the destruction functionality he has seen, however can be ready to see how dependable the system is.
The size of 374Water’s present expertise is small: it will possibly deal with only a fraction of the tonnes of moist sludge the ability produces day by day.
However the firm is within the technique of scaling up, and Mr Oyler imagines in just a few years will probably be in a position to deal with all the ability’s materials “prepared for when the rules require”.
Different applied sciences on their method to being commercially prepared embody hydrothermal alkaline therapy (HALT), which makes use of excessive temperature, excessive stress, and an alkaline chemical to destroy PFAS; and plasma-based expertise, which includes making an ionized gasoline (known as a plasma) to assault and degrade the PFAS molecules.
AquaggaBut there may be one potential subject with the applied sciences now coming by way of, says Jay Meegoda, a professor of civil and environmental engineering on the New Jersey Institute of Expertise: nasty PFAS degradation byproducts.
For instance, within the case of EO, extremely corrosive hydrogen fluoride vapor. Every wants a “full examine” accounting for all their inputs and outputs, he says.
The businesses have claimed they both do not produce PFAS degradation merchandise or take care of them adequately.
One essential companion for most of the PFAS destruction firms in testing their applied sciences in the true world has been the US Division of Defence (DOD).
PFAS contamination at US navy websites is an enormous, below-the-radar drawback. It stems significantly from the usage of older formulations of firefighting foam, used for instance throughout coaching workouts or emergencies, however different routes too such because the cleansing of navy gear.
Greater than 700 websites are recognized or suspected to be contaminated, posing a risk to surrounding communities. A decide just lately cleared the best way for PFAS contamination and hurt lawsuits towards the navy to proceed.
Clear up efforts are the place the destruction firms may are available in, and initiatives have been undertaken or are below means at numerous websites to evaluate the efficiency and value effectiveness of a lot of their options.
One start-up, Aquagga, which specialises in HALT expertise, just lately accomplished an indication challenge for the DOD which concerned destroying a firefighting foam combination amongst different concentrated PFAS-containing liquids.
Immense volumes of the froth are at the moment stockpiled in all kinds of locations, not simply at navy websites.
Like others, Aquagga sees an enormous alternative over the subsequent few years for each destroying the froth and remediating the environmental harm related to its use.
And outdoors the navy, there is a tantalizing new PFAS waste stream on the horizon. The US is actively increasing home pc chip manufacturing – a course of that makes use of PFAS in huge quantities. “We will destroy that,” says Mr Gannon, of 374Water.
